Kloster Hermetschwil Kloster Hermetschwil Infos Facts Map The Benedictine convent of St. Martin is located in Freiamt. Founded in 1082, the monastery complex is one of the most impressive cultural sites in the region.

This is a river crossing, Dominilochsteg, a wooden bridge that was built for pedestrians and cyclists to cross the Reuss. It was built in 1988. It is made of spruce wood and rests on concrete pillars. It is used very often by many people. A very nice photo opportunity.

Legend of Egelsee: Among the knights who once lived in our land there were many godless and violent people. No traveler on the road, no seed in the field, no ox at the plow and no carving in the trough were safe from them. They robbed, burned and murdered whatever fell into their hands. Such a monster of a knight also lived in a castle on the Heitersberg. His name was Riko. But his castle was called Bauernweh because it only brought misery and misfortune to the farmers in the area. For the knight went out every day with wild dogs and rough companions in arms and returned to his castle in the evening with heavy robbery. On the way back from one such foray, they once came to the farm of a widow who had not been able to pay the interest on time. The monsters packed up the woman's belongings, drove her and her children out of the house and set it on fire. The mother only wanted to take a handful of flour with her to make porridge for her youngest child. Then the knight tore the child from her arms and threw it into the flames. "Now there's no need for porridge anymore," he sneered and ran off with his flock. The mother knelt in agony by the burning house and begged heaven to have mercy on the people and end their misery. And heaven heard the lamentation of the unhappy mother. That same night a terrible storm hit the area. Lightning flashed down on the castle without interruption, and with a mighty crash it sank, along with all hands, a hundred fathoms deep into the abyss. The following morning a deep, black lake lay where she had sunk. For a long time he was feared and avoided by people. It's the Egelsee

The region around Boswil offers several beautiful natural spots. You can visit Egelsee, a lake known for its idyllic setting and a local legend about its formation. Another significant lake is Flachsee, notable for its nature reserve where water buffalo can often be observed grazing. The Dominiloch Footbridge over the Reuss River also provides magnificent views of the river and surrounding landscape.
Yes, the area boasts rich historical and cultural experiences. Hallwyl Castle, a romantic moated castle, allows visitors to explore its rooms and learn about an Aargau noble family. Boswil is also home to the Künstlerhaus Boswil, a cultural foundation dedicated to music, hosting high-caliber concerts and workshops in a historic setting.

The Dominiloch Footbridge over the Reuss River is a nearly 100-meter-long wooden pedestrian and cyclist bridge. It offers magnificent views over the Reuss River, the surrounding landscape, and the Monastery of St. Martin. It's an ideal spot to enjoy the peaceful natural environment and observe the azure blue Reuss.
